8. Acacia yunnanensis Franchet, Pl. Delavay. 193. 1890.
云南相思树 yun nan xiang si shu
Shrubs, 4-5 m tall, pubescent throughout, generally unarmed; old branches with recurved prickles on internodes. Stipules deciduous, oblong; petiole with raised, elliptic gland; pinnae 5-15 pairs, 2-5 cm; leaflets oblong, 4-10 × 1.8-2 mm, midvein close to upper margin, both surfaces sparsely pubescent, base obtuse-rounded, apex acute. Racemes 2-5 cm, 2- or 3-fasciculate or arranged in panicle. Calyx ca. 2.5 mm. Corolla ca. 5 mm; lobes ca. 2 mm, densely golden tomentose. Filaments ca. 1.1 cm. Ovary pubescent, with ca. 1 mm stipe; style ca. 3 mm. Legume oblong, ca. 15 × 2-3 cm, base attenuate, stalklike, apex long acuminate, slightly constricted between seeds. Seeds brown, flat. Fl. May.
● Thickets; 1700-2200 m. Sichuan, Yunnan.
